NDRF team rescues 8-yr-old girl from quake rubble in Turkey
New Delhi: The NDRF team in coordination with the Turkish Army has successfully rescued an eight-year-old girl from Gaziantep in quake-hit Turkiye, it said in a tweet.
The NDRF said: “Hard work & motivation pays."
“NDRF team in coordination with Turkish Army successfully rescued another live victim (Girl aged 8Yrs) @ 1545hrs at Loc:Bahceli Evler Mahallesi, Nurdagi, Gaziantep, Turkiye," read the tweet.
Earlier, the National Disaster Response Force (NDRF) team in Turkiye had rescued a six-year-old girl in Gaziantep city from under the rubble of damaged buildings.
